Web12 nov. 2024 · Using loppers or hand pruners, remove dead, damaged, crossing, and crowded branches back to the base of the plant. Avoid shearing flowering shrubs with hedge shears. Cut back to a bud that faces out, away from the central stem or trunk. New growth will emerge from this bud, so you want it to grow outward, not inward. Web9 apr. 2024 · Identify the branches that need pruning and make a clean cut just above the bud or node. Use bypass shears for delicate plants and anvil shears for thicker branches. Make sure your head shears are positioned at the correct angle to ensure a clean cut. Remove any debris or dead material from the plant after pruning to prevent disease.

WebTo shorten, use thinning cuts. Permanent branches should be spaced 6 to 24 inches apart on the trunk, depending on the final mature size of the tree. On smaller trees, such as dogwoods, a 6-inch spacing is adequate, whereas spaces of 18 to 24 inches are best for large maturing trees like oaks. Web3 mei 2024 · Pruning Shears Explained: Choose the Best Pruners For Your Garden Epic Gardening 2.15M subscribers Subscribe 1.7K 88K views 3 years ago Pruning is one of the most common tasks … WebUse alcohol or bleach to disinfect equipment between each cut when pruning diseased plants. Mix at the rate of one part bleach to nine parts water. At the end of the day, oil the pruning equipment well to avoid rusting. There are many kinds of hand pruning shears. Most of them are designed for cutting stems up to 1/2 inch in diameter.

Some tree branches are too thick for conventional loppers and pruners. Big, mature trees usually have branches at least 3 inches in diameter. You’re better off using a pruning saw for pruning that requires more effort. A pruning saw is a manual saw with a narrower blade than a conventional wood saw. flight pc1162Web15 aug. 2024 · Use the right tools.
